About Sarah
Sydney based, dynamic primary school educator with over 20 years experience supporting children and adults with diverse needs online or on Northern Beaches / North Shore. Experienced in developing inclusive lesson plans that enhance learning engagement and promote individualized growth. Skilled in fostering a supportive environment through effective communication and tailored instructional strategies. Committed to empowering learners to achieve their fullest potential through individualized learning experiences. Qualified Primary School teacher, specializing in the Montessori Method and Neurodiverse learners.
